Eric Braeden Signs New Contract With THE YOUNG AND THE RESTLESS

Eric Braeden has signed a new deal with Sony TV that will keep him on the THE YOUNG AND THE RESTLESS for years to come, according to EW.com.

“Very glad we got the negotiations successfully behind us,” Braeden said in a statement. Terms of his multi-year deal were not released.
